Important

❒ The Rotating Collate function requires two paper trays containing same size

paper but in different orientations.

❒ If the output tray has shift function, Shift Collate will be applied even if Ro-

tating Collate is selected.

When Rotate Collate is cancelled

If the following functions are selected, Collate or Shift Collate will be applied
even if Rotating Collate is selected:
• When combined with staple function.
• If jobs containing pages of various sizes are set.
• If custom size paper is set.

Note

❒ When Rotating Collate has been selected, printing speed will be slower than

with other collate functions.

Shift Collate

The optional finisher is required for this function.
The finisher shift tray moves backward or forward when a job or set is output,
causing the next to shift, so you can separate them.

Important

❒ This function is not available when you select the following paper type;

• Label paper
• OHP paper

Note

❒ If you select the thick paper in this function, the paper is delivered to the Fin-

isher shift tray.
